1、 1 摘 要 随着商品化经济的发展,超市规模的不断扩大,商品的不断曾多,随之而来 的就是商品管理的问题, 只依靠人工的记账管理体制已经无法适应当代超市的发 展,这就需要有一个先进的管理系统来管理如此繁杂的商品信息。 超市管理系统是市场上最流行的超市上常用的系统之一, 它主要包含以下几 个模块:员工管理,进货管理,销售管理,库存管理,信息统计。从而,实现 对进货、销售及员工信息等实现全面、动态、及时的管理。 本文系统的分析了软件开发的背景和流程。 对系统的各模块进行了详细的说 明,通过应用程序与数据库的连接进一步提升了软件的性能。 关键字:超市 数据库 2 第1章 绪论 1.1 课程设计的目的
2、通过本次课程设计,使学生能够全面、深刻地掌握数据库系统的设计流程。 根据在数据库原理课程中所学到的数据库理论知识,结合某个具体的实际需求, 最终开发出一个较为实用的数据库系统。 1.2 课程设计的背景和意义 1.2.1 课程设计的背景 20 世纪 90 年代后期特别是近几年,我国的超市产业飞速发展,其经营模式 更为复杂,旧的管理体制已经无法适应超市的发展,这就迫切的需要引进新的管 理技术。 超市的数据和业务越来越庞大,而计算机就是一种高效的管理系统,这就需 要我们把超市的管理与计算机结合起来,从而超市管理系统应运而生。依靠现代 化的计算机信息处理技术来管理超市,节省了大量的人力、物力,改善了员
3、工的 并且能够快速反映出商品的进、销、存等状况和各种反馈信息分析,使管理人员 快速对市场的变化做出相应的决策,加快超市经营管理效率。 1.2.2 课程设计的意义 “数据库课程设计”的设计思想旨在强调学生的实际编程能力的培养与创意 灵感的发挥。为此,本课程结合学科特点,除了让学生掌握数据库原理的理论知 识,还增加了需求功能让学生完成,并鼓励学生的创作出个性的程序,满足客户 需求,与市场的实际项目相结合。学生对此热情高,实际收获大,效果好。通过 课堂学习和参与相关项目设计,学生对书本支持有了深刻的理解,实践性教学取 得了良好效果。 3 1.3 课程设计环境 操作系统:Windows xp/vist
4、a 开发软件:Microsoft Visual Studio 2005 数据库:Microsoft SQL Server 2005 4 第 2 章 系统需求分析 随着人们生活水平的不断提高,对于物质的需求也越来越高,而超市作为日 常生活用品聚集的场所,随着全球各种超市的数目的不断增加,规模不断增大, 其管理难度也相应的增加,而为了适应当今信息化发展的时代,一套完整的超市 商品管理系统显得尤为重要。 2.1 问题的提出 在信息化高速发展的今天, 超市商品管理的信息化管理已成为必不可缺的一 部分,但是目前的大多是超市商品管理系统应用难度较高,许多工作需要技术人 员配合才能完成,角色分工不明确;改版工作量大,系统扩展能力差,应用时更 是降低了灵活性, 这就使得一套完善的、 能够正常工作的商品管理系统应运而生。 2.2 可行性分析 系统的可行性分析是对课题的通盘考虑, 是系统开发者进行进一步工作的前 提,是系统设计与开发的前提与基础。系统的可行性分析可以使系统开发者尽可 能早的估计到课题开发过程中的困难,并在定义阶段认识到系统方案的缺陷,这 样就能花费较少的时间和精力,也可以避免许多专业